Output 59e23c9a8a3e49c76716b64cc4e711d67f06acb3e477d69d6bfa7aaac52143fe:0

value
51341800
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 44c23b53ae12b7adfaf14840ff0642ba12314343 OP_EQUALVERIFY OP_CHECKSIG
address
17GZdWAEUZzdupC3Kwc1Xkmr9AJ7mv5UqL
transaction
59e23c9a8a3e49c76716b64cc4e711d67f06acb3e477d69d6bfa7aaac52143fe
confirmations
541613
spent
true